Q: Is 66,513,310 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 66,513,310 is a composite number.

Why is 66,513,310 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 66,513,310 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 173 346 865 1,730 38,447 76,894 192,235 384,470 6,651,331 13,302,662 33,256,655 and 66,513,310, with no remainder.

Since 66,513,310 cannot be divided by just 1 and 66,513,310, it is a composite number.
